    Accuracy of spectral analysis methods for precision indoor positioning system

  • Original language description

    At the University of Pardubice there is currently developed a modern positioning system for localization of fire brigade and members of rescue corps. The TDOA based system use an OFDM wideband signal to separate direct propagated signal from mixture of its replicas created in a multipath channel. In the paper, the model of a received signal is presented and this signal is processed by spectrum analysis methods to estimate the direct propagated signal delay. The accuracy of nonparametric, parametric andsubspace methods is compared and new insights into application of spectral analysis methods are presented.
